Today’s top news from Hungary covers a range of topics, from historical landmarks to tragic events and political developments. Here is a summary of the latest updates:

At the Hungarian-Austrian border, there has been talk of the potential end of the Schengen Zone, sparking protests among locals.

A heartbreaking incident near Berekfürdő saw the discovery of the body of a 10-year-old German boy, with details emerging about his mother’s actions.

In a surprising turn of events, Ryanair has announced the closure of one of its oldest routes from Budapest, affecting travelers.

On a lighter note, Budapest is set to welcome two new Danube beaches and pools this summer, offering more recreational options for residents and visitors.

The closure of the Mary Magdalene Tower, one of Buda Castle’s oldest buildings, has been announced, with plans for a reopening in the future.

In Hungary’s history, lesser-known details about the Royal Crowns of Hungary and the iconic Ikarus brand have been brought to light through exhibitions and research.

Shifting to political matters, the Hungarian government is advocating for the removal of certain Russian figures from the EU sanctions list, while also addressing security concerns related to a Ukrainian drone attack.
